Confirmed Date of Michael Jackson’s Death

Michael Jackson passed away at the age of 50 on June 25, 2009. He suffered cardiac arrest at his home in the Holmby Hills neighborhood of Los Angeles.

Emergency responders attempted to revive him before transporting him to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center. Despite extensive efforts, doctors pronounced him dead later that afternoon.

This date has been firmly established through official records and remains unchanged in all verified accounts.


What Caused Michael Jackson’s Death

The official cause of death was acute propofol and benzodiazepine intoxication. The manner of death was ruled a homicide.

Here’s a simple breakdown:

  • Primary drug involved: Propofol
  • Additional substances: Lorazepam, diazepam, and other sedatives
  • Outcome: Cardiac arrest leading to death

Michael Jackson had been using medications to treat severe insomnia in the weeks leading up to his death.

His personal doctor, Conrad Murray, later faced trial and was convicted of involuntary manslaughter in 2011. He served time in prison for his role in administering the drugs.


Detailed Timeline of June 25, 2009

A closer look at the final hours provides clarity on how events unfolded.

Morning hours:

  • Jackson stayed at home preparing for upcoming tour rehearsals
  • He had ongoing issues with sleep

Around midday:

  • He was given propofol to help him rest
  • Shortly after, he became unresponsive

Emergency response:

  • 911 was called
  • CPR began immediately at his residence

Early afternoon:

  • He was taken to UCLA Medical Center

2:26 PM:

  • Doctors officially declared his death

Nationwide and Global Reaction

Michael Jackson’s death created an immediate worldwide response. In the United States, fans gathered outside his home, the hospital, and major landmarks.

Key reactions included:

  • Massive spikes in internet searches and online traffic
  • Radio stations playing his music nonstop
  • Record-breaking increases in album and digital sales

A public memorial service held on July 7, 2009, at the Staples Center drew millions of viewers globally.


His Career at the Time of His Passing

At the time of his death, Michael Jackson was preparing for his highly anticipated comeback tour, “This Is It.” The shows were scheduled in London and had already sold out.

Major career highlights include:

  • More than 400 million records sold worldwide
  • One of the most awarded artists in music history
  • Groundbreaking albums such as Thriller, Bad, and Dangerous

Thriller continues to hold the record as the best-selling album of all time.

Memorial and Public Tributes

The memorial service in Los Angeles became one of the most watched live events in history.

Highlights included:

  • Emotional speeches from family members
  • Performances honoring his music
  • A widely shared tribute from his daughter, Paris Jackson

The event reflected the global admiration for his life and work.
